An X-ray beam, of intensity I0, is used to examine the flow of blood through an artery in the leg of a patient. The beam passes through an equal thickness of blood and soft tissue.

The thickness of blood and tissue is 5.00 mm. The intensity of the X-rays emerging from the tissue is It and the intensity emerging from the blood is Ib.

The following data are available.

Mass absorption coefficient of tissue    = 0.379 cm2 g–1
Mass absorption coefficient of blood     = 0.385 cm2 g–1
Density of tissue                                    = 1.10 × 103 kg m–3
Density of blood                                     = 1.06 × 103 kg m–3

State and explain, with reference to you answer in (a)(i), what needs to be done to produce a clear image of the leg artery using X-rays.

Markscheme

the difference between intensities is negligible so no contrast ✔

modifying the blood is easier than modifying the soft tissue ✔

increase absorption of X-rays in the blood ✔

by injecting/introducing a liquid/chemical/contrast medium ✔

with large mass absorption coefficient/nontoxic/higher density ✔
